Hi all
I'm using a full set of Aborea Low volume cymbals with my Drumit 5 MKII.
They feel great.
I purchased a GoEdrums hihat sensor and their trigger housing as well as an edge membrane so I can have the hihat with bow and edge
The problem I'm having is that I can't get the edge membrane to make any sound at all when its plugged into the hihat trigger input.
The membrane does work - when I plug the hihat triggers into the snare trigger input, I get the snare head and snare rim sounds. But I get nothing plugged into the hihat input.
Cant find anything in the manual or anything online after exhaustive google searches
I'm sure i'm missing something basic?
